Almost 30 years after Emschwiller prepared IZnCH 2I, Simmons and Smith discovered that the reagent formed by mixing a zinc‐copper couple with CH 2I 2 in ether could be used for the stereospecific conversion of alkenes to cyclopropanes. The Simmons-Smith (SS) cyclopropanation is a general and efficient method for the conversion of olefins into cyclopropanes. The stability and usefulness of the Simmons-Smith reagent (zinc metal) may be attributed in part to the higher covalency of the carbon-zinc bond together with solvation and internal coordination of the zinc (which makes the zinc complex stable). The Simmons-Smith reaction seems to have the essential feature that higher electron density at the carbon-carbon unsaturation enhances the rate of the cyclopropane formation") due to the electrophilic nature of the reagent, thus resulting in better yields.
